E

Edward Chea
Review of Funsize

9 months ago

I had a great experience working with Funsize.co. ...

I had a great experience working with Funsize.co. Their designs are innovative and their attention to detail is impressive. The team was professional and delivered high-quality work. I highly recommend them!

Comments:

No comments